| Aspect | Temporary Christmas Tree Farm | Christmas Tree Harvester |
|---|
| Credentials | No formal certifications typically required | Usually no formal certifications, but experience with machinery is beneficial |
| Work Environment | Outdoor farm setting, seasonal, often in rural areas | Outdoor, working with specialized harvesting equipment on farms |
| Employer & Industry | Christmas tree farms, seasonal employment | Tree farms, forestry industry, seasonal harvesting |
| Work Tasks | Planting, caring for, and harvesting Christmas trees | Operating machinery to cut and gather Christmas trees |
In summary, a Temporary Christmas Tree Farm involves broader farm activities including planting and caring for trees, while a Christmas Tree Harvester focuses specifically on using machinery to harvest the trees. Both roles are seasonal and outdoor, but the harvester requires familiarity with equipment.
